    Factors to Consider When Choosing Hot Toys For 7 Year Old Boys

    Choosing the right hot toy for a 7-year-old boy involves considering several factors beyond just the toy’s theme. It’s important to think about the child’s interests, whether they prefer racing, building, or imaginative play. Durability is key, as toys for this age group tend to see rougher handling. Additionally, toys that can evolve or expand offer more value over time. Safety features and ease of setup are also critical, especially for busy parents or younger children just learning to handle complex toys.

    Play Style and Interests

    Identify whether the child prefers high-energy activities like racing and action, or creative projects such as building and constructing. Toys like Hot Wheels track sets cater to kids who love fast-paced, competitive play, while LEGO sets are better suited for those who enjoy imaginative building and storytelling. Matching the toy to their interests ensures sustained engagement and reduces frustration or disinterest. Avoid toys that don’t align with their preferred play style to maximize enjoyment and value.

    Durability and Safety

    At age 7, children are often quite energetic with their toys, so durability becomes a primary concern. Look for products made from sturdy materials that can withstand rough handling without breaking or losing parts. Safety features such as non-toxic materials, rounded edges, and secure fastening are essential to prevent accidents. Avoid overly complicated toys that might frustrate or pose safety risks if not assembled properly. Well-built toys tend to last longer and provide better long-term value.

    Expandability and Reusability

    Opt for toys that can be expanded or reconfigured, offering more play options over time. Sets like Hot Wheels tracks that can be connected with other tracks or LEGO kits that can be rebuilt into different models provide ongoing interest. This approach maximizes the investment, especially when budgets are tight or when the child’s interests evolve. Be mindful that some expandable sets may require additional purchases, so consider what future additions might be needed.

    Ease of Setup and Use

    Ensure the toy is straightforward to assemble and operate, especially for younger children who are still developing fine motor skills. Toys with complicated instructions or many small parts can lead to frustration. Look for sets with clear instructions and minimal parts that are easy to handle. Quick setup also means more immediate fun, rather than waiting long periods for assembly or troubleshooting, which can dampen enthusiasm.

    Price and Overall Value

    Price varies widely within this category, often reflecting the complexity and scope of the toy. Balance your budget with the features and longevity you desire. Sometimes spending a bit more on a high-quality, expandable set results in better durability and more extensive play options over time. Conversely, budget-friendly options can be perfect for casual or temporary interest. Keep in mind that pricier sets shouldn’t necessarily be more complex if the child is still developing skills or patience.

    Frequently Asked Questions

    How do I choose a toy that my 7-year-old will actually enjoy?

    Understanding their interests is the first step. If they love speed and competition, racing sets like Hot Wheels are ideal. For creative kids, LEGO or building kits offer endless possibilities. Observe what they play with most and consider their favorite themes—whether vehicles, action figures, or construction. Also, involve them in the decision if possible, to ensure the toy matches their current passions. The right fit promotes longer engagement and more fun.

    Are expandable toys worth the extra investment?

    Expandable toys often provide more value because they can grow with the child. Sets that can be reconfigured or combined with additional pieces extend the lifespan of the toy and keep play fresh. However, they may require ongoing purchases to unlock their full potential, which can add up over time. If your child is likely to enjoy building and customizing, investing in expandability makes sense, but if they prefer ready-to-play sets, simpler options might be better.

    What safety features should I look for in toys for this age group?

    Safety features include non-toxic materials, rounded edges, and secure fastening of small parts to prevent choking hazards. Toys should also meet safety standards set by relevant authorities, which is usually indicated on the packaging. Avoid toys with loose or easily breakable parts that could pose risks. Choosing well-reviewed, reputable brands reduces the likelihood of safety issues and ensures compliance with safety regulations.

    How much should I expect to spend on a good hot toy for a 7-year-old?

    Prices can range from around $20 for basic sets to over $100 for more complex or larger playsets. Generally, investing in a mid-range toy offers a balance of quality, durability, and value. Premium options with extra features or expandability tend to cost more but can last longer and provide more engaging play. Consider your budget and the child’s interests to find the best option without overspending on features they might not use.

    Are higher-priced toys necessarily better?

    Not always. Higher prices often reflect additional features, larger size, or brand reputation, but that doesn’t guarantee better suitability for your child’s preferences. Focus on whether the toy matches their interests and offers good durability and safety. Sometimes a well-chosen, moderate-priced toy can provide just as much fun and engagement as a more expensive option, especially if it aligns with their play style and developmental stage.
